Output 16f63cf81a2f1fd5e18f6542bfcc17887440625e11284ded2df7ea0a989a6610:0

value
32299999
script pubkey
OP_0 OP_PUSHBYTES_20 7d51fedd9a441d1e2280e34d2bc68a9fee6c284e
address
ltc1q04glahv6gsw3ug5qudxjh352nlhxc2zwrqpm7r
transaction
16f63cf81a2f1fd5e18f6542bfcc17887440625e11284ded2df7ea0a989a6610
spent
true